WebWilk test (Shapiro and Wilk, 1965) is a test of the composite hypothesis that the data are i.i.d. (independent and identically distributed) and normal, i.e. N(µ,σ2) for some unknown real µ and some σ > 0. This test of a parametric hypothesis relates to nonparametrics in that a lot of statistical methods (such as t-tests and analysis of ...

Accuracy and HRT were analyzed by ANOVA test, and if significant, post-hoc tests with Bonferroni correction were performed, … memorial for a musicianWeb2 nov. 2014 · shapiro.test(x) >W = 0.9965, p-value = 1.484e-09 Here I started with a very large norm. dist. and added a small norm dist. to it with a different mean. The difference is hardly visible to the eye, but the P value is very small. The reason is that the large sample size makes it possible to detect even very small deviations from normality. memorial follow my health loginWebJust try to run the following command in R several times: shapiro.test (runif (9)) This will test the sample of 9 numbers from uniform distribution.
